- Synopsis
- Two aspiring boxers, lifelong friends, get involved in a money-laundering scheme through a low-level organized crime group. Bobby is a struggling boxer and bodyguard for his stripper girlfriend. But he hates his work and wants to move up. So he agrees to go to New York City for his boss to help in the delivery for a money laundering scheme. His partner in crime is his best friend Ricky, an obnoxious loudmouth who has seen one too many mafia movies. Bobby tries to keep it cool and get the job done, but Ricky's antics threaten to blow the entire situation.

"Favreau, who wrote 'Swingers,' has now directed and written the hilarious 'Made', which re-teams him with Vaughn. The two play off each other so well that they recall fond memories of Jack Lemmon and Walter Matthau"
-
"The movie's success with viewers will depend on whether they think Vaughn is funny or tiresome"
-
"A peculiarly entertaining comedy, revisits the rapport that Favreau and Vaughn had in "Swingers" (1996), and rotates it into a deadpan crime comedy."
-
"The film's a trifle, but a beautifully crafted one"
-
"It's often hilarious, and there is lots of the zippy, apparently improvised dialogue that made "Swingers" such a pleasure."
